The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in the East Midlands with a requirement for Software Engineering sk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ited Software Engineering over the 6 months to 26 April 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
26 Apr 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 20 21 22
Rank change year-on-year +1 +1 +1
Permanent jobs citing Software Engineering 361 296 335
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the East Midlands 8.36% 10.35% 9.61%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 10.33% 10.76% 10.47%
Number of salaries quoted 284 165 169
10th Percentile £38,000 £37,500 £36,250
25th Percentile £41,250 £41,250 £42,500
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£50,000 £55,000 £52,500
Median % change year-on-year -9.09% +4.76% +5.00%
75th Percentile £65,000 £72,500 £70,000
90th Percentile £78,750 £85,000 £82,500
England median annual salary £62,500 £72,500 £70,000
% change year-on-year -13.79% +3.57% +12.00%
